Story.

A judge has ordered Microsoft to stop selling Word due to (what else?) patent infringement. Apparently some company complained about Microsoft infringing on their patent for using XML in a certain way.

This will probably be overturned, of course, but it's still amusing.

(Try and overlook the fact that the article calls XML "essentially a programming language".)
